Not all Invisalign providers are the same
Invisalign ranks its provider network into tiers based on experience and the number of cases successfully completed. A general dentist who treats a handful of aligner cases per year is in a different category than a provider who has treated hundreds.
When you choose a Premier Preferred Provider, you are choosing a dentist who:
- Has completed extensive Invisalign-specific training
- Treats a high volume of clear aligner cases annually
- Meets Invisalign's standards for treatment quality and patient outcomes
- Can handle a wider range of cases — from minor cosmetic shifts to more complex bite corrections
Experience matters with orthodontics. Small adjustments in treatment planning can mean the difference between finishing on time and needing extra aligners — or between a beautiful result and a compromised one.

How Invisalign treatment works
Invisalign uses a series of custom clear aligners that gently shift your teeth into position. You wear each set for about one to two weeks, then switch to the next set in the series.
Because aligners are removable, you can eat what you love and brush normally. Most people will not even notice you are wearing them — which is why Invisalign is so popular with working professionals across Torrance and the South Bay.
Treatment requires consistency: aligners should be worn 20 to 22 hours per day for the best results. Dr. Sheth monitors your progress at regular check-ins and adjusts the plan as needed.

Frequently asked questions
What is the difference between Premier Preferred and a regular Invisalign provider? Premier Preferred Providers have completed significantly more Invisalign cases and met higher standards for treatment quality. That experience benefits you directly in treatment planning and outcomes.
How long does Invisalign take? Most treatments take 6 to 18 months. Simple cosmetic cases may finish faster; comprehensive bite corrections take longer. Dr. Sheth maps your timeline at your consultation.
Is Invisalign only for teenagers? Not at all. A large percentage of our Invisalign patients are adults — many in their 30s, 40s, and beyond who want a straighter smile without metal braces.
